We love pork! This was excellent and easy yet company quality. My cranberries look darker b/c my tenderloin was not completely defrosted when I started so I just cooked the pork longer using a meat thermometer and took out of the oven when it was around 162 degrees and then tented with foil. I served this with a rice dish and Greek Cauliflower-another yummy dish. Thank you Boomie for another phenomenal recipe! Made for 1-2-3 Hit Wonders.

This was delicious! Instead of a pork tenderloin, I did pork chops and these had a great taste. I just fried them up in the pan until done, then fried the onion and garlic, added the additional ingredients and cooked for about 10 minutes. This was great to use up some cranberries I had stocked up on. Thanks, Boomette1!
